The Story of a New Generation: Setting the Stage

Two years after the end of the Bloody Valentine War depicted in Gundam SEED, Destiny introduces a new generation of pilots caught in the crossfire of a renewed conflict. The PLANTs, a space colony nation, and the Earth Alliance are once again locked in a bitter struggle for power. This time, however, the conflict is not simply a clash of ideologies, but a complex web of political intrigue, personal vendettas, and the ever-present threat of advanced mobile suit technology.

The series introduces Shin Asuka, a young PLANT pilot with a fiery spirit and exceptional skills in piloting the Destiny Gundam, one of the most powerful mobile suits ever created. He becomes embroiled in the conflict, witnessing firsthand the devastating consequences of war and grappling with difficult choices regarding loyalty, friendship, and survival. Unlike Kira Yamato from the original SEED, Shin is often portrayed as more impulsive and less idealistic, making his character arc particularly compelling.

The Legacy of Gundam SEED Destiny

Gundam SEED Destiny remains a highly debated entry in the Gundam franchise. While it builds upon the foundation established by Gundam SEED, it also makes bold changes in terms of its narrative direction and character development. Some fans praise the series for its ambitious storylines, intense battles, and memorable characters, while others criticize its pacing and character writing.

However, regardless of individual preferences, the impact of Gundam SEED Destiny on the Gundam universe is undeniable. It introduced new mobile suit designs, technologies, and characters that have continued to influence subsequent entries in the franchise. Its exploration of complex themes such as war, peace, and the consequences of technological advancements also resonate with audiences.
